Top Wearable Devices for Fitness Tracking

Top Wearable Devices for Fitness Tracking

The wearable device market continues to grow, with several devices standing out for their effectiveness in tracking fitness. Two notable examples are the Fitbit Charge and Garmin Vivosport. These devices have gained popularity due to their seamless integration with fitness apps and customization options.

The Fitbit Charge boasts advanced sleep tracking features, guided breathing sessions, and a battery life of up to 7 days. In contrast, the Garmin Vivosport offers GPS tracking, VO2 max estimates, and stress tracking capabilities. Both devices allow users to personalize their experience with customizable watch faces and interchangeable bands.

Best Smartwatches for Health Monitoring

Choosing the Right Smartwatch for Health Monitoring

The wearable device market has witnessed a significant shift in focus from mere fitness tracking to advanced health monitoring. Top smartwatch brands now offer a range of health features, including ECG readings, blood oxygen level tracking, and fall detection. The Apple Watch Series and Samsung Galaxy Watch stand out for their seamless health app integration, enabling users to track their health metrics and connect with healthcare professionals easily.

When selecting a smartwatch for health monitoring, it’s essential to consider the device’s compatibility with existing health apps and its ability to provide accurate and reliable data. Compatibility is key to ensuring that users can track their health metrics without interruptions or inconsistencies.

Additionally, accuracy and reliability are crucial in health monitoring, as incorrect or inconsistent data can lead to misdiagnosis or delayed treatment.

Other notable smartwatches that offer substantial health features at an affordable price point include the Fossil Gen and Skagen Falster. These devices provide users with a range of health tracking features, including heart rate monitoring, sleep tracking, and GPS tracking.

Wearable Devices for Stress Management and Tracking

Stress Management with Wearables: A Growing Trend

Wearable devices have expanded their capabilities beyond tracking physical activity and sleep patterns to play a crucial role in managing and tracking stress levels. Recent advancements have equipped wearables with features such as stress relief exercises, mindfulness tracking, and heart rate variability monitoring. Users can now track their stress levels and engage in relaxation techniques to mitigate stress.

The Science Behind Wearable Stress Management

Studies have shown that wearables can be effective in reducing stress and anxiety by promoting mindfulness and self-awareness. A study published in the Journal of Clinical Psychology found that wearable devices can help individuals develop healthier coping mechanisms and improve their overall well-being.

Popular Wearable Devices for Stress Management

Some popular wearable devices for stress management include smartwatches and fitness trackers that offer guided meditation sessions and breathing exercises. For example, the Apple Watch offers a built-in “Breathe” app that guides users through relaxation exercises.

Fitbit’s “Relax” feature provides personalized breathing sessions to help users unwind.

User Experience: The Most Comfortable Wearables

The Importance of Comfort in Wearable Devices

Wearable devices have become increasingly advanced in tracking health parameters, but comfort has emerged as a crucial factor in determining their overall effectiveness. Studies have shown that user comfort significantly impacts adherence to wearable device usage. When devices are designed with comfort in mind, users report higher satisfaction rates.

A study analyzing user feedback found that devices with flexible bands and compact designs received higher comfort ratings compared to bulkier models. Users prioritized devices with customizable sizes and hypoallergenic materials, highlighting the importance of considering individual needs. For instance, devices like the Fitbit Inspire HR and Garmin Vivosport offer interchangeable bands and compact designs, catering to different wrist sizes and preferences.

Assessing the Value of High-End Wearable Devices

Assessing the Value of High-End Wearable Devices

High-end wearable devices offer a range of advanced features that set them apart from more basic models. These features include built-in GPS, cellular connectivity, and real-time health metrics, which can be valuable for individuals seeking extensive health tracking.

However, these premium features come at a cost, with high-end wearables often priced between $300 and over $1,000. For those who require detailed health tracking, the investment in a high-end device may be justified.

On the other hand, individuals with more basic tracking needs may not find the added cost worthwhile. To determine the best device for one’s health tracking goals, it’s essential to conduct a thorough assessment of features and costs.

Understanding the Cost-Benefit Analysis

A cost analysis of high-end wearable devices reveals a significant price gap compared to more basic models. Devices with advanced features like GPS and cellular connectivity can range from $300 to over $1,000.

While these features may be beneficial for some, others may not find them necessary.
